1. Personal Benefits: Why They Matter

Imagine you're sharing stories about the joys of spinning wool into yarn. While summarizing its practical benefits or celebrating friendships formed through a common interest can certainly engage listeners, it’s the personal benefits that truly hit home. The ability to craft something beautiful with your own hands, the relaxation that comes with repetitive motions, and the sense of achievement are personal experiences that tug at the heartstrings. Wouldn't you agree that engaging your audience on a personal level makes the speech more memorable?

It’s one of those essential truths: when people can relate the content to their own lives, they’re far more likely to remember it. So, rather than just throwing out the factual benefits of wool spinning—like the wool's warmth or durability—sharing those personal experiences fosters a deeper connection between you and your audience.

2. The Call to Action: Because Why Not?

Here’s the thing: after you've conveyed the emotional benefits, you want your audience to feel compelled to act. What are you encouraging them to do? It could be as simple as inviting them to join a local knitting circle, sign up for an online class, or even just start their own wool-spinning project at home. A call to action acts like a spark that lights a fire within your audience, making them eager to try something new.

Think about it: if your conclusion includes a strong call to action, not only are you reinforcing the message you’ve shared, but you’re also providing them with tangible options. How could your audience resist the urge to explore this newfound interest?

Rhetorical Flourishes to Remember

While you're working on your conclusion, keep in mind the power of rhetorical questions and vivid imagery. For instance, you might ask, “Can you imagine the calming rhythm of pulling fibers together, creating something unique and personal?” Such questions linger in the atmosphere, nudging your audience toward introspection.

Additionally, sprinkle in imagery that reflects the tactile and vibrant world of wool—think soft textures, rich colors, and the meditative nature of the craft. This kind of sensory engagement keeps your audience tuned in and features prominently in an unforgettable conclusion.

Putting It All Together: A Sample Wrap-Up

Let's say you’re closing your speech on spinning wool. You might say something like:

"Now that we’ve explored both the practical and emotional sides of spinning wool into yarn, let me leave you with this. Imagine the soothing sound of the wheel and the satisfaction of creating a scarf that holds your warmth. Not only do you gain a skill, but you also join a community, share stories, and experience joy. So, who’s ready to dive into the world of wool knowing they have the power to create something beautiful? Let's spin!"

Simple, huh? This wrap-up reiterates the personal benefits, encourages excitement, and provides a catchy call to action all in one go.
